Try to avoid payday loans if at all possible. Since they come at exorbitant costs which will cost you up to $15 per two weeks with an apr totaling 391%!
You don’t have to take payday loans if you can put your finances fully under control. If you have enough cash or credit to meet the emergencies, you can keep yourself away from the disastrous effects of payday loans.

If the need to borrow payday loan still persists, then make sure that you borrow only that much amount which you will be able to pay back within the due date. If you are facing shortage of cash during that period, try for some other funds from other sources. Don’t roll for cash advances since this is the worst thing that one can do to himself or herself.
